Don’t expect to find in Uvita a last-generation, well-equipped fishing boat. Uvita is located within a National Park, so here, all the boats are just standard and not specifically orientated towards the professional activity of sport fishing. However, the waters are incredibly rich and with a very experienced captain (10+ years of sailing in the area), you may make some nice catch!
Choose a half-day inshore fishing trip to catch Mackerel, Roosterfish, Snapper, or Tuna or a full-day offshore fishing trip to capture Mackerel, Wahoo, Mahi-Mahi, Yellowfin Tuna, Black Tuna, or Snapper. Techniques used are trolling, casting, and in some places: bottom fishing. Also, with a full-day trip, you will get a chance to enjoy a refreshing snorkeling session at Caño Island which is considered one of the best spots in Costa Rica for snorkeling and scuba diving.
Prices for a private boat start at $595 for a half-day trip or $1,100 for a full-day trip (depending on the number of people and the season of the year – lunch included if you choose a full-day trip).
